So far the only item that builds out of the item 2049 Sightstone is the item 2045 Ruby Sightstone, right? Not many people build it until their last item, some not at all. I was thinking of ways to improve this, maybe making it cheaper or something... and then I came up with what I think is a decent idea.

Sightstone enchantments. I didn't come up with any great ideas for enchantments but here's just a few suggestions off the top of my head to show you what I mean.

Ruby Sightstone = Holds 5 charges instead of 4. Emerald Sightstone = Vision area is increased by 20% Topaz Sightstone = Wards can be placed from 33% further away. Diamond Sightstone = Wards last 30 seconds longer. Onyx Sightstone = Vision area is decreased to 20%, but the first enemy champion that is spotted by it will be Revealed for 5 seconds.

These are just examples, ignore them if you want. But the concept itself... what do you think?

To the actual suggestion, the idea of having several sightstone enchantments is interesting, though I do wonder how much it could really serve to address the problem you're seeking to solve. If I had to guess, I'd say that the reason it's not commonly upgraded until later in the game is due to the fact that it doesn't add a ton of combat stats. However, it may also be that it's because it doesn't really add a new unique passive, which is essentially what your suggestion does. That said, I do wonder if spending gold on a non-combat passive would also lack appeal.

I'd also ask, is people not upgrading their Sightstones until very late in the game even an issue? Would players actually be more interested in Sightstone if they felt compelled to upgrade it before buying their Mikael's, Locket, Righteous Glory, etc.?

A reason to build a higher level sightstone might be nice, but truth is it would be just like the different enchants/blade combinations for junglers. There will be one that is superior to all others (increased vision area, for example) and would be the only one built. There aren't reasons to have the other "enchants" so it would just be wasted coding. Like poacher's knife or essence reaver, they would just be wasted item code. As we have it right now, adding the little bit of health it has is an alright option to upgrade your sightstone to. It doesn't make it an overpowered option for someone trying to scale their percent health, but does provide a little resistance from dying in the late game.
